ISE仿真流程

这篇具有很好参考价值的文章主要介绍了ISE仿真流程。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

以半加器为例,记录一下使用ISE仿真的步骤。

1、新建工程

ISE仿真流程

2、选择开发板型号,综合工具选择XST,仿真工具选为Isim

ISE仿真流程

 3、检查信息,没有问题点击finish

ISE仿真流程

4、在代码管理区任意位置单击鼠标右键,选中new source

ISE仿真流程 5、代码类型选择verilog Module,输入文件名称

ISE仿真流程

 6、端口定义,"port name"表示端口名称,Direction表示端口方向,MSB表示信号最高位,LSB表示最低位,对于单位信号MSB和LSB可以不用写。

ISE仿真流程

 7、检查信息,没有问题点击finishISE仿真流程

 8、模块和端口定义会自动生成,对于未定义的端口信息可以修改或者补充

ISE仿真流程

 9、代码编写完毕,使用综合工具XST,点击如图所示位置进行代码综合

ISE仿真流程

 10、直接点OK

ISE仿真流程

 11、添加工程,然后点击创建原理图

ISE仿真流程

 12、经过综合后的RTL级结构图

ISE仿真流程

 13、接下来进行仿真测试。在源码管理区将View设置成Behavioral Simulation,在任意位置单击鼠标右键,选择new source

ISE仿真流程

 14、选择verilog test fixture,输入文件名

ISE仿真流程

 15、选中要测试的模块

ISE仿真流程

 16、检查信息,没有问题点击finish

ISE仿真流程

 17、编写测试代码,完成后选中tb文件,设置仿真属性

ISE仿真流程

 18、可以在属性设置中设置仿真时间

ISE仿真流程

 19、设置完成即可进行仿真

ISE仿真流程

 20、如果仿真不通过,可以在下方点击error查看仿真错误并修改代码

ISE仿真流程

 21、代码无误,会自动启动ISE Simulator软件,并得到如图所示的仿真结果。

ISE仿真流程

 文章来源地址https://www.toymoban.com/news/detail-487787.html

 

到了这里,关于ISE仿真流程的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 记录一下使用vs2022 上传到gitee项目

    第一个红框的地址一会需要用到

    2024年02月16日
    浏览(62)
  • 记录一下在工作中使用 LayUI bug的问题

    前言: LayUI是一个很老的框架了,经常会碰到一些 bug。不过由于他的轻量级,仍然有一些项目在使用。之前在公司解决的这些 bug,现在有时间发出来,可能会对大家产生一些意义。 layui中 slect form表单元素 不美化显现的问题 layui中美化的表单元素 在渲染完成要添加 form.ren

    2024年02月11日
    浏览(40)
  • 记录一下易语言post get使用WinHttp的操作

    最近在学易语言,在进行通讯的时候,出现一些问题,现在记录下来,避免以后继续忘记, 先声明文本型变量jsonPostData .变量搞定了 然后声明一个对象变量httpObj post方法如下: get 方法如下: 亲自测试能通过,稳稳的在运行

    2024年04月17日
    浏览(35)
  • ISE软件使用小结

    以标号顺序进行经验总结: 放大;缩小;适应界面(一般在点击3箭头所指处之后使用,在适应界面的状态后进行放大,是查看波形的一般步骤)。 (mark):放置轴,以便直观显示一个周期,上述波形图均采取此方式。 单点Run all会 出现波形消显的情况,还需人工判断进行暂

    2024年02月11日
    浏览(49)
  • ISE 14.7基础使用方法

    https://electronics.stackexchange.com/questions/112415/the-idcode-read-from-the-device-does-not-match-the-idcode-in-the-bsdl-file https://support.xilinx.com/s/article/13529?language=en_US#:~:text=If%20both%20Initialize%20Chain%20and%20Get%20Device%20IDCODE,opened%20or%20if%20the%20devices%20were%20added%20manually.

    2024年02月05日
    浏览(44)
  • 【FPGA入门】第二篇、ISE软件的使用

    目录 第一部分、新建工程 第二部分、添加顶层文件 第三部分、添加管脚约束文件 第四部分、生成bit文件 第五部分、连接开发板,下载bit文件 第六部分、总结 第一步、如果提前建立了工程文件夹,那么这里就需要去掉生成子文件夹的路径。 因为ISE软件输入工程名称后自动

    2024年02月09日
    浏览(51)
  • 记录在苹果mac os系统上使用51单片机仿真软件Proteus

    1.安装Wineskin shell 指令 2.安装Wrapper 点击update ​​​​​​​ 首先我们需要安装一个程序: 可以将在Windows系统上才能运行exe文件打包为mac系统可执行的文件。 下载后,可以在启动台或者下载目录看到 Wineskin Winery 的图标,点击启动该软件。  No Wrapper Installed   暂时无法解决

    2024年02月06日
    浏览(63)
  • 【VCS+Verdi联合仿真】~ 以计数器为例

    首先,先声明一下,我写这篇博客的时候我就是一个纯小白,实不相瞒,刚刚学了一天,哈哈哈,没错,你没看错,就是一天!!!主要是因为前天因为刷题和找工作的需要,需要熟悉VCS和Verdi的联合仿真(据说是很好用,随大流呗!!!),所以才会有接下来的一些相关博

    2023年04月12日
    浏览(35)
  • 商业流程服务BPass你真的了解吗?

    商业流程服务(BPaaS)是一项云资源的审批流程服务,可以帮助您管理账号下的资源申请与分配。您无需创建多个腾讯云账号来管理不同业务的资源,而是在一个腾讯云账号下管理和分配资源。管理员创建不同的资源审批流,申请人可根据业务需求发起流程,待流程审批通过

    2024年02月09日
    浏览(63)
  • 浅浅记录一下对某音的X-Agus、X-Gorgon、X-Khronos、X-Ladon研究(仅学习使用)

    近期比较闲,于是对该app进行了逆向研究 前两年也对这个app进行了研究,那时候还没有什么加密参数 可以很正常的进行采集 现在发现连包都抓不到了 于是查看了相关资料 发现该app走的不是正常的http/s协议 于是我hook了传输协议 就可以正常抓包了 抓包后就发现多了好几个加

    2024年01月19日
    浏览(38)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包